Chris Tye

Paperclip Heart E.P.

Label:

emellett by Ed***d Mellett May 7th, 2003

Without even opening the slightly dog-eared plastic case before me I can see that both time and love (probably with a greater emphasis on the latter) have gone into this record. A perfectly hand crafted green paperclip has been gently placed in the back of this little package. It fits the mood of the CD perfectly.

Throughout the Paperclip Heart E.P. lush vocals harmonise with beautiful and subtly epic open chords, a light mood-sensitive drumbeat rhythmically steadying and caressing the sounds of the music. At times you could call this reminiscent of Starsailor, but unlike them Chris Tye is good. It feels like the words in these songs are truly meant and they lap perfectly with the intoxicating melodies. Perhaps a slower, more relaxed and lovable version of Biffy Clyro would be a better description. As the CD comes to its final track I’m getting that slightly weepy ‘Saturday morning watching Dawson’s Creek’ kind of feeling.. but unusually I kind of like it.

A product of true exquisiteness; a beautiful thing to be both loved and treasured.
